#593bf3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#593bf3 is composed of 34.9% red, 23.1%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 75.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 249.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 59.2%. #593bf3 color hex could be obtained by blending #b276ff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#593bf3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020007 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#593bf3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94939b is the less saturated color, while #5433fb is the most saturated one.
